解決本地主機無法連接MySQL數據庫問題
在日常開發(fā)中,我們經常需要連接本地數據庫進行程序測試,但有時候使用localhost卻無法連接到MySQL數據庫,而使用127.0.0.1卻能夠成功連接。為了方便測試,我們需要對電腦進行適當的配置,以
在日常開發(fā)中,我們經常需要連接本地數據庫進行程序測試,但有時候使用localhost卻無法連接到MySQL數據庫,而使用127.0.0.1卻能夠成功連接。為了方便測試,我們需要對電腦進行適當的配置,以確保localhost也能夠成功鏈接到MySQL數據庫。
建立本地數據庫
首先,我們可以使用Navicat for MySQL等工具在本地建立一個數據庫,這樣可以為后續(xù)的連接測試提供數據支持。
創(chuàng)建測試網頁
在Dreamweaver等開發(fā)工具中創(chuàng)建一個PHP格式的網頁,用于測試與數據庫的連接情況,這將幫助我們驗證配置的準確性。
檢查連接錯誤信息
在測試過程中,如果無法使用localhost連接到MySQL數據庫,通常會收到錯誤提示信息。這是我們需要關注的關鍵點。
修改hosts文件
若出現無法連接的情況,我們需要修改系統(tǒng)中的hosts文件。位于C:WindowsSystem32driversetc目錄下的hosts文件是指定主機名與IP地址之間對應關系的配置文件。
編輯hosts文件
使用記事本或其他文本編輯器打開hosts文件,在其中找到包含"127.0.0.1 localhost"的行,刪除該行中的“”符號,然后保存修改。如果沒有這一行,則手動添加該條目。
重新測試連接
保存修改后,再次使用之前創(chuàng)建的測試網頁進行連接測試,此時應該能夠順利通過localhost連接到本地的MySQL數據庫。這樣就解決了無法連接的問題。
通過以上步驟,我們可以解決本地主機無法連接MySQL數據庫的常見問題,確保順利進行程序測試和開發(fā)工作。這些配置調整不僅能提高工作效率,同時也有助于更好地理解和掌握本地環(huán)境與數據庫連接的原理。